Market Context

EKSO has seen normal trading activity in recent weeks, with volume levels hovering around its 30-day average, with no significant spikes or drops in trading interest that would signal unusual institutional positioning. The broader medical robotics and wearable therapeutic device sector has seen mixed performance this month, as investors weigh potential tailwinds from increasing adoption of post-injury rehabilitation technologies against headwinds from tightening healthcare reimbursement policies in some major markets. EKSO has a moderately positive correlation with other small-cap medical technology stocks in recent trading, meaning broader sector moves could potentially amplify its near-term price swings. There have been no material corporate announcements from Ekso Bionics Holdings Inc. in the past few weeks, so price action has been largely disconnected from company-specific fundamental news, leaving technical levels as a key focus for active traders monitoring the stock. Technical Analysis

From a technical perspective, EKSO currently sits between two well-established short-term price levels. The immediate support level is $10.54, a price point that has acted as a reliable floor for the stock in recent weeks, with buyers consistently entering the market to push prices higher each time EKSO has approached that level. The immediate resistance level sits at $11.65, a threshold that the stock has tested twice in the past month but failed to close above on both occasions, indicating significant selling pressure near that price point. Key momentum indicators show the RSI for EKSO is in the mid-40s to low 50s range, suggesting the stock is neither overbought nor oversold at current levels, leaving room for potential moves in either direction without triggering extreme momentum signals. The stock is currently trading above its short-term moving average range but below its medium-term moving average range, creating mixed trend signals that could lead to increased volatility as traders weigh short-term momentum against medium-term trend direction. Outlook

Looking ahead, there are two key scenarios to monitor for EKSO in the coming weeks. If the stock manages to break above the $11.65 resistance level on above-average volume, that could potentially signal a shift in short-term momentum, with follow-through buying interest possibly pushing the stock into a new higher trading range. Conversely, if EKSO fails to break through resistance in the next few sessions, it could possibly retest the $10.54 support level; a break below that support on high volume might lead to increased short-term selling pressure as traders who entered near the support level exit their positions. Broader market sentiment towards the healthcare and medical technology sectors will likely be a key driver of EKSO's performance in the upcoming weeks, as will any unexpected corporate announcements from the company. Many active traders in the small-cap medical tech space are monitoring EKSO's price action as a barometer for sentiment towards emerging rehabilitation technology players, given its status as one of the more liquid publicly traded firms focused exclusively on exoskeleton devices.
